Some of the best smooth jazz recordings are found on this greatest compilation by Oklahoma City based producer and composer, Gary Fuston. The Best Of G. Fuston features beat heavy styles influenced mainly by hiphop. One of the more recommended tracks is Day After, which is a 100% radio ready song and features a brilliant and cool chorus section. Gary Fuston not only has hiphop in mind, but some tracks like Passion For Pleasure are more atmospheric oriented and is comparable to some of the soundtrack of Final Fantasy VIII. Another blend of smooth guitar and cool beats can be found on The A.M. Drive. Other smooth favorites from this greatest collection are When I Get There, In The Moment and Fade To Bass. If you're looking for pure 100% upbeat and cool instrumental music, then this is the CD you'll really want. Wouldn't be surprised if Gary signed on to a major recording label.
Comentary quotes from Ted Hasiuk's show On Café Jazz, Canada's Smooth Jazz Connection Heard It Before - Gary Fuston: Fuston has been involved in production work for the past 15 years or so, although his passion for music goes back much further. As a student he took up drums, percussion, & guitar. In the late 70's he was part of an R&B group and shortly thereafter he became interested in learning the engineering side of recording. In that connection, he set up his own studio and over the years has produced many artists from a variety of genres. In 1999, he introduced his own music online which resulted in over a million downloads and streams and the start of a worldwide fan base. His latest album titled the Best of G. Fuston, is a collection of 15 tracks from two previous releases on mp3.com which are no longer available to listeners. The music is a blend of acid jazz, jazz fusion, and smooth jazz and features guitar, strings, and piano layered with danceable grooves and rhythmic melodies.
